The most important thing to consider in any bunk or loft bunk beds for kids bed is the safety aspect. The frame should be constructed of solid wood, and the ladder or stairs should be securely attached to the bed. The custom bunk beds for kids bed should also be secured with guardrails at the top of the bed to prevent children from falling off and getting injured.

4. Kids Space-Saving Bed Bed with Stairs

If your child is more comfortable climbing ladders than a bunk bed, you may be interested in a bed with stairs. Staircases are more space-consuming however they are safe for kids who aren't able to reach the top bunk using ladders. They also allow parents to quickly access the top bunk if they need to get up their children or read their children a bedtime tale.

The stairs can be fixed or moveable based on the model you select. Fenton says that some bunk beds have the ladder positioned at the shorter end. This is a good option because it lets the storage or furniture to be placed under the bunk bed without blocking the ladder. Some bunks have ladders that can be moved to the left or right side of the bunk. Both options have pros and cons. Think about what will best suit your family before deciding.

Many of these bunks with stairs come with a twin over full or a full over twin mattress. This makes them ideal for families who host frequent sleepovers or have siblings sharing in a bedroom. A lot of models have a built-in twin bed that can accommodate additional guests without taking up valuable room space.

Whether you choose ladders or stairs, make sure you choose high-quality materials and a design that suits your child's personality and style of the rest the room. It is also important to check the weight limit for each mattress, in order to ensure that your child does not exceed the limits. It is also important to measure the floor space to ensure the bunks will fit, and leave a few inches between the frame and the walls to avoid the risk of slipping.
